Two goals and two assists summed up the Spaniard’s brilliant match Gabriel Veiga on the fifteenth day of Saudi Leaguewhere his team, the Al Ahlibeat the Abha (0-6) to come close to second place in the classification led by Al Hilal.
Veiga, who has so far scored only one goal for his team, scored two more in his best match in the Saudi competition. He opened the scoring after twenty minutes with an assist Frank Kessie in the 38th, which made the fourth, which Riyad Mahrezat 64, who signed the sixth.
The former player of Celtic He also scored the fifth, in a great individual move that ended with a shot from almost no angle that beat the Romanian goalkeeper. Ciprian Tatarusanu.
Fairs Al Brikan He scored a double to complete Al Ahli’s scoring tally, which is third in the standings, four points behind Al Nassr and eight points behind the leader, Al Hilal.
The clash between Al Riyadh and Al Hazem ended goalless.
